About the Webinar

This webinar will give attendees a preview of the content to be available at the conference this September 12-15 in Trento, Italy. Attendees of the webinar are encouraged to participate and express their views and interests, thereby helping to further shape conference content. The conference theme, Improving the Citizens’ Quality of Life, will factor into the material presented. Dario will be joined in presentation by conference track co-chairs in the areas of Smart Government, Health and Well-Being, Smart Energy Systems, Smart Transportation, Big Data and Open Data, and Privacy and Security.

Speakers include:

  • Moderator: Dario Petri, University of Trento, Italy, IEEE International Smart Cities Conference 2016 Chair
  • Technical Program Committee Co-chairs: Soufiene Djahel, Manchester Metropolitan University, UK, and Bernardo Tellini, University of Pisa, Italy
  • TRACK Smart Energy Systems Co-chairs: Carlo Alberto Nucci, University of Bologna, Italy, and Davide Brunelli, University of Trento, Italy
  • TRACK Big data & open data Co-chairs: Andrea Molinari, University of Trento, Italy, and Frederick Mintzer, IBM TJ Watson Research, Center
  • TRACK Privacy and security Co-chair: Andrea Lanzi, University of Milano, Italy

About R8

Welcome to Region 8 (Europe, Middle East and Africa) of the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E)

The IEEE is the world’s largest technical professional society, and comprises more than 360,000 members who conduct and participate in its activities in 150 countries.
Founded in 1884, the IEEE is a non-profit organisation, and through its members is a catalyst for technological innovation. We are a leading authority in a broad range of areas such as computer engineering, electric power, aerospace and consumer electronics, biomedical technology, and telecommunications, naming only a few.
We publish 30 percent of the world’s literature in electrical engineering, computers and control technology, and hold more than 300 major conferences and 6,000 local meetings annually. Recognized as essential guides for every industry, more than 800 active IEEE standards are in use today with 700 currently in development.
